public class PercolatorBackwardsCompatibilityIT extends ESIntegTestCase {
@Test
public void testPercolatorUpgrading() throws Exception {
// Simulates an index created on an node before 1.4.0 where the field resolution isn't strict.
assertAcked(prepareCreate("test")
.setSettings(settings(Version.V_1_3_0).put(indexSettings())));
ensureGreen();
int numDocs = randomIntBetween(100, 150);
IndexRequestBuilder[] docs = new IndexRequestBuilder[numDocs];
for (int i = 0; i < numDocs; i++) {
docs[i] = client().prepareIndex("test", PercolatorService.TYPE_NAME)
.setSource(jsonBuilder().startObject().field("query", termQuery("field1", "value")).endObject());
}
indexRandom(true, docs);
PercolateResponse response = client().preparePercolate().setIndices("test").setDocumentType("type")
.setPercolateDoc(new PercolateSourceBuilder.DocBuilder().setDoc("field1", "value"))
.get();
assertMatchCount(response, (long) numDocs);
// After upgrade indices, indices created before the upgrade allow that queries refer to fields not available in mapping
client().prepareIndex("test", PercolatorService.TYPE_NAME)
.setSource(jsonBuilder().startObject().field("query", termQuery("field2", "value")).endObject()).get();
// However on new indices, the field resolution is strict, no queries with unmapped fields are allowed
createIndex("test2");
try {
client().prepareIndex("test2", PercolatorService.TYPE_NAME)
.setSource(jsonBuilder().startObject().field("query", termQuery("field1", "value")).endObject()).get();
fail();
} catch (PercolatorException e) {
e.printStackTrace();
assertThat(e.getRootCause(), instanceOf(QueryParsingException.class));
}
}
}
